ENTP/ENFP relation:
Generating Ideas. Thinking Feeling boundaries are not very thick. So they can relate well, much more efficiently than the ENFP/INTP bonding.
ENTP/ENFP share common ground on the primacy of Extroverted Intuition whihc is basically a raw idea engine. Both tend to have a very high social consciousness, and both are primarily concerned with finding problems in society and coming up with powerful visions of change.
The ENTP will use his critical thinking skills to point out what is wrong in society, and offer solutions on how it can be done. ENFP will envision the situation, and recommend the most humane ways to go about it, and how impersonal ideas about how those problems can be solved can be tied to the personal problems and how the human element can be taken care of.
The ENTP/ENFP bond is the synthesis of imeprsonal vision on how to carry society forward with the personal. Again the theme is laying out a powerful vision of change.
Now here are some general comments on your chart:
ENTP: The innovator-Comes up with impersonal ideas on how to solve many of the objectively observable problems in society.
ENFP: Same notion as the ENTP, although with a personal approach. Mostly concerned with the elevation of social consciousness and making the external world a better place.
INTJ: An internal visionary. Concerned with impersonal ideas in regards to how the individual can make the world a more accomodating place for himself. Unlike the ENTP, he insists not on changing the external world and seeing how you measure up to it, but by how you can make yourself a more adept person to the point where you could twist the world to your liking. So the INTJ is the same kind of a visionary as an ENTP, although internally focused, yet just as dispassioned and impersonal, and thus more individualistic because of Introversion. And sees the final goal as the state where the world conforms to your principles, and not you working towards social consciousness and making it a better place yourself. This is a salient distinction of the Ne and Ni, introversion/extroversion. A great example of such INTJ prophets would be embodied in the teaching of Friedrich Nietzsche's Zarathustra, and Rand's ethical egoism.
INFJ:The type that is the most concerned with bringing meaning to one's individual vision. Same notion as the INTJ, though the vision must be lived out personally with no other task than giving the individual meaning to life. Unlike the more theoretical INFP, who just tries to weigh out what is important, the INFJ is concerned with actions that need to be taken in order to find the meaning in life that the INFP longs for.
INFP: The most theoretical about the human element. Primarily concerned with weighing things out for the sake of finding inner harmony of feelings. And knowing on a cerebral level, what is necessary in order for one to be at peace with oneself, and find meaning in life. Unlike the INFJ, the INFP is much less concerned with acting out on their beliefs. In many respects, the INFJ expounds and seeks cerebral implementation of the vision of the INFP.
ENFJ:The implementor of the ENFPs vision, the popularizer.
ENTJ:The implementor of the ENTP's vision.
INTP: As analogous to thought as the INTP to feelings. The most theoretical about impersonal ideas, yet not strongly concerned about acting out on convictions. As analogously to the INFP-INFJ relationship, the INTJ is oftenly the expounder and the cerebral implementor of the ideas of the INTP.
So the INTP first propounds a theory. The INTJ gives it more depth and points out the practical implementation and sends it back to the INTP. The INTP tweaks it up and gives the INTJ criticisms, and then they strive for the synthesis of ideas and prepare their theory for presentation to the outer world. Than the ENTP connects it to the world of ideas and passes it down to the ENTJ, who is the primary implementor.
Same diagram applies to the way NFs handle personal affairs.
